Activates a new job or restarts a job that has been suspended.
HRESULT Resume( );
This method has no parameters.
This method returns the following HRESULT values, as well as others.
||Job was successfully restarted.|
||There are no files to transfer.|
||The state of the job cannot be BG_JOB_STATE_CANCELLED or BG_JOB_STATE_ACKNOWLEDGED.|
When you create a job, the job is initially suspended. Calling Resume moves the job from the suspended state to the queued state. The job stays in the queued state until the scheduler determines it is the job's turn to transfer files. Note that the job must contain one or more files before calling this method. If the job is of type BG_JOB_TYPE_UPLOAD_REPLY and you want to specify the name of the reply file, you should call the IBackgroundCopyJob2::SetReplyFileName method before calling Resume.
If a job that is in the BG_JOB_STATE_TRANSIENT_ERROR or BG_JOB_STATE_ERROR state, call the Resume method to restart the job after you fix the error.
|Windows version||Windows XP Windows Server 2003|